“He Can Return The Ball From Day One” On Australian Fields – Sachin Tendulkar vividly recalls Shane Warne’s memorable moments


The sudden death of the Australian spin legend Shane Warne stunned the cricket world earlier this month. On March 4, the 52-year-old suspect died of a heart attack. He was found unresponsive in his villa in Thailand and could not be revived despite the best efforts of the medical staff. Almost a month later, praise continues to pour in for Warne, who is widely considered the greatest spinner to ever play the game.

Warne died of a heart attack at the age of 52 earlier this month.

“I first played against him in 1991. We were training against the Prime Minister’s XI. And then there’s a stocky, strong, blond man bowling. The emphasis was on other bowlers; At this point, I had played international cricket for several years and the emphasis was on the rest of the offensive. “But Shane came along and made some incredible deliveries.” Sachin Tendulkar He said it in a video posted on his YouTube channel and 100MB app.

“He wasn’t as accurate as he was later in his career, but it was clear that he had strong fingers, good wrist position, strong shoulders, and he ripped it off well.” I was beaten a few times while the ball was spinning. The ball did not initially spin on Australian surfaces, but as the game progressed, the ball began to spin. “But Shane managed to spin the ball from the very beginning,” he added.

Sachin Tendulkar He went on to say that he last saw Warne in London, where he returned after IPL 2021. They got together and even went golfing.

After the last IPL I went to England to spend some time in London, where we got in touch and planned to play a round of golf.” It was fun. There was never a dull moment when Shane was around. It was full of laughter and jokes, and during our mini-battles, I realized that what came naturally to him was not just spin, but swing. He was an excellent golfer. I hate to say it is because we have to accept what happened. He will live in our hearts.

Shane Warne played 145 Tests and 194 ODIs between 1992 and 2007, claiming a total of 1001 wickets throughout his illustrious career. He played a key role in Australia’s 1999 World Cup victory.

Sachin Tendulkar explains why India has yet to become a sports powerhouse

India is one of the sports crazy countries in the world. Outside of cricket, he has failed to transform himself into a sports powerhouse. Likewise, Sachin Tendulkar believes that India lacks a complete sports culture and delays its goal of becoming a sports powerhouse.

Sachin Tendulkar said at the Apollo Tires Sports Conclave in Mumbai on Tuesday that while everyone in the country enjoys watching sports, only a few enjoy it. As a result, he called for transformation to begin at the grassroots level. He has once again advocated making sports compulsory in schools and believes that candidates should be allowed to practice the sport of their choice.

“This will also enable experts to identify talents at an early stage. At the end of the day, we want to build a more fit and healthy India that can perform well in everything,” he said. Also, once the child’s skill in a particular sport has been identified, a good sports infrastructure to enrich his or her abilities stressed that appropriate guidance, boot camps, and more should be given to them.
